Is Gloria Glens Park a Good Place to Live?
Economy & Jobs
Gloria Glens Park residents earn a median household income of $68,438 , which is 9% below the national average of $75,149. Per capita income is $36,352. The unemployment rate stands at 6.2% (72% above the U.S. rate of 3.6%). 4.5% of residents live below the poverty line. The area is home to 5,238 business establishments, including 338 restaurants.
Housing & Cost of Living
The median home value in Gloria Glens Park is $162,500 , 42% below the national median of $281,900. Zillow estimates the typical home at $158,461. Median rent is $1,148/month, with 24.0% of renters spending more than 30% of income on housing. The cost of living index is 92.8 (100 = national average). The median home was built in 1953.
Safety & Crime
Gloria Glens Park reports 230 violent crimes per 100,000 residents , which is 39% below the national average of 380/100K. Property crime is 874/100K.
Education
25.3% of adults in Gloria Glens Park hold a bachelor's degree or higher (25% below the national average). 95.8% have completed high school. Local schools score 6.9/10 in standardized testing.
Climate & Weather
Gloria Glens Park has an average annual temperature of 49°F (9°C). Winters average 25°F in January while summers reach 71°F in July. The area gets 275 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 40.6 inches.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 43.
